Autodesk 라이선스 서버 및 클라이언트에서 지정된 포트를 변경하는 방법

Autodesk Support

2024년 8월 12일


다루는 제품 및 버전


문제:

Autodesk 라이선스 서버 및 클라이언트에서 할당된 포트 2080(adskflex 공급업체 데몬) 및 27000-27009(lmgrd 마스터 데몬)를 변경하는 방법을 알고 싶습니다.

원인:

여러 개의 Flexlm 기반 라이선스 서버가 동일한 라이선스 서버에서 호스트되었습니다.

해결 방법:

IANA(Internet Assigned Numbers Authority)에서 Autodesk 제품에 대한 FLEXnet 라이선스 관리자에게 다음 포트를 공식적으로 할당합니다.
 

서비스 및 관련 포트:
lmgrd 마스터 데몬: 27000-27009
adskflex 공급업체 데몬: 2080
 

네트워크에서 포트 2080 및/또는 27000–27009를 사용하는 다른 응용프로그램을 실행하고 있고 해당 응용프로그램을 다른 포트에 재배치할 수 없는 경우 할당된 포트를 변경하여 다른 포트를 사용할 수 있습니다.

참고: 이러한 변경 사항은 다른 응용프로그램과 충돌을 생성할 수 있으므로 Autodesk에서 공식적으로 지원하지 않습니다. 반드시 필요한 경우가 아니라면 포트를 변경하지 않는 것이 좋습니다.
 

서버에서 포트를 변경하는 방법:

포트를 변경하려면 서버의 라이선스 파일을 수정하여 SERVER 줄에서 포트 번호를 할당하고 VENDOR 줄에서 다른 포트 번호를 할당해야 합니다. 예:

원래 라이센스 파일(처음 3줄):

SERVER Master01 00d0b757050C0
USE_SERVER
VENDOR adskflex port=2080

수정된 라이센스 파일(처음 3줄):

SERVER Master01 00d0b757050C0 27500
USE_SERVER
VENDOR adskflex port=2099

 

클라이언트에서 포트를 변경하는 방법:

ADSKFLEX_LICENSE_FILE 환경 변수를 사용 중인 경우 @서버 이름 앞에 라이선스 서버 포트를 추가할 수 있습니다.

예:
ADSKFLEX_LICENSE_FILE=27500@Master01 또는 ADSKFLEX_LICENSE_FILE=2099@Master01.

라이선스 파일을 수정하고 클라이언트 시스템에서 LICPATH.LIC 파일도 수정할 수 있습니다.
라이센스 서버의 위치를 제품에 알려주는 파일입니다.
 

Windows의 경우: 
  • Autodesk 소프트웨어 버전 2017 이상의 경우 LICPATH.lic 파일은 C:\ProgramData\Autodesk\CLM\LGS\<제품 키>_<제품 버전>.0.0.F에서 찾을 수 있습니다. 
    • 예를 들어 AutoCAD 2019의 경우 파일 위치는 C:\ProgramData\Autodesk\CLM\LGS\001K1_2019.0.0.F입니다.
  • Autodesk 소프트웨어 2016 이하 버전의 경우 LICPATH.lic 파일은 대개 Autodesk 프로그램의 루트 폴더(예: C:\Program Files\Autodesk\Civil 3D 2015)에서 찾을 수 있습니다.
Mac OS X의 경우:
  • Autodesk 소프트웨어 버전 2017 이상의 경우 LICPATH.lic 파일은 /Library/Application Support/Autodesk/CLM/LGS/<제품 키>_<제품 버전>.0.0.F에서 찾을 수 있습니다.
    • 예를 들어 AutoCAD 2018 for Mac의 경우 파일 위치는 /Library/Application Support/Autodesk/CLM/LGS/777J1_2018.0.0.F입니다.
  • Autodesk 소프트웨어 버전 2016 이하의 경우 클라이언트 라이선스 파일의 위치는 일반적으로 /var/flexlm입니다.
  • ~/.flexlmrc 파일에서 라이선스 파일 위치를 찾을 수 있습니다. 터미널에서 cat ~/.flexlmrc 명령을 실행하여 터미널에 .flexlmrc 파일의 내용이 표시되면 ADSKFLEX_LICENSE_FILE의 값을 확인합니다.
Linux의 경우:
  • 클라이언트 라이선스 파일은 여러 폴더(대부분의 경우 /var/flexlm/)에서 찾을 수 있습니다. 
  • ~/.flexlmrc 파일에서 라이선스 파일 위치를 찾을 수 있습니다. 터미널에서 cat ~/.flexlmrc 명령을 실행하여 터미널에 .flexlmrc 파일의 내용이 표시되면 ADSKFLEX_LICENSE_FILE의 값을 확인합니다.
  1. 라이선스 파일에서 할당한 것과 동일한 포트 번호를 추가하여 이 파일의 SERVER 줄을 업데이트합니다.
SERVER Master01 00d0b75705020 27500
USE_SERVER
 
  1. LICPATH.LIC 파일을 찾을 수 없는 경우 라이선스 파일에 있는 다음 정보가 포함된 텍스트 파일을 .LIC 확장자로 저장하여 라이선스 파일을 작성할 수 있습니다.
SERVER   
USE_SERVER
  1. 클라이언트와 서버 둘 다 lmgrd 마스터 데몬에 동일한 포트를 사용하고 있는지 확인합니다.
  2. 수정 사항을 적용하려면 시스템을 재부팅해야 합니다.

참고. 대체 포트를 지정하면 포트 범위가 아닌 특정 단일 포트만 사용하도록 제한됩니다.

제품:

모든 데스크톱 제품;


이 정보가 도움이 되셨습니까?


도움이 필요하신가요? Autodesk Assistant에게 물어보세요!

Assistant가 답변을 찾아내거나 상담사에게 연락하는 것을 도와드릴 것입니다.


어떤 지원을 받을 수 있는지 확인하세요.

서브스크립션 플랜에 따라 제공되는 지원 유형이 달라집니다. 보유하신 플랜에 대해 제공되는 지원 수준을 확인하십시오.

지원 수준 보기